Software Engineer - Revit, C#, .NET

BRAINTRUST

  • Nigeria
  • Contract
  • Full-time
  • 1 month ago
Company description Braintrust is the first decentralized Web3 talent network that connects skilled, vetted knowledge workers with the world’s leading companies...Job Ad & Profile DescriptionPosition : Software Engineer - Revit, C#, .NETAbout UsCollaborative 3D building design tool (Think Figma for building designs).More than 4k users globally with renowned firms like WeWork, Square Yards, etc implementing projects on Snaptrude. Backed by Accel Partners, Foundamental, Tiferes VC among other notable investors.What you'll be working on
  • Develop and maintain Revit API-based tools, scripts, and add-ins
  • Integrate addins with Snaptrude web applications for seamless interoperability
  • Collaborate with architects, engineers, and other stakeholders to design and automate workflows
  • Troubleshoot and debug issues related to Revit API-based tools
  • Convert between various other formats such as IFC, RVT, FBX, OBJ, DWG, PDF etc. as per project requirements
  • Conduct research and stay up-to-date on the latest developments in Revit API and BIM technology to identify opportunities for improvement and innovation
  • Provide training and support to other developers on the use of Revit/AutoCAD API-based tools
  • Added benefit if experience with ODA(Open Design Alliance) API
  • Automate build and deployment for addins
Required profile for job ad : Software Engineer - Revit, C#, .NETRequirementsQualifications
  • Experience - 2-3 years required
  • Strong proficiency in Revit API programming using .NET languages such as C# or VB.NET
  • Solid understanding of BIM principles, including experience with Revit and other BIM software
  • Sound geometry and math concepts
  • Proven object-oriented programming skills, design patterns
  • Design, build, and maintain efficient, reusable, and reliable code
  • Experience working in a hosted environment, for example, AWS, GCP, Heroku is desired
  • Experience with software development methodologies and tools, such as Agile, Git, and Visual Studio
Interview process:
  • 1) 15-minute intro call to meet the Snaptrude team
  • 2) Technical interview + 45 min tech asessment
  • 3) Final call with the CEO
Please note that this is a short-term contract (2-3 months)Job criteria for job ad : Software Engineer - Revit, C#, .NET Job category :IT, new technologies
Industries :IT, software engineering, Internet
Employment type :Fixed-term contract
Region :

Nigeria Job

Similar Jobs

  • Middle Software Engineer C++ (Gameplay)

    PLAYRIX

    • Nigeria
    Company description Playrix is an international mobile game developer and the creator of such hit games as Gardenscapes, Fishdom, Fishdom Solitaire, Manor Matters,... Job Ad & Pr…
    • 1 month ago
  • Lead Software Engineer C++ (Gameplay)

    PLAYRIX

    • Nigeria
    Company description Playrix is an international mobile game developer and the creator of such hit games as Gardenscapes, Fishdom, Fishdom Solitaire, Manor Matters,... Job Ad & Pr…
    • 1 month ago
  • Software Engineer

    CareerBuddy

    • Lagos, Lagos State
    Job Description: Welcome to an opportunity to join a dynamic team as a Software Engineer. Our client is committed to pushing the boundaries of technology to deliver innovative so…
    • 1 month ago